Sat 808601893721402

decimal
161720.1893721402
degree
0°161720′440″1893721402‴
percentile
38.504852124326874%
name
icvakhyokpb
cycle
0
epoch
0
period
80
block
161720
offset
1893721402
timestamp
rarity
common